It will be one of the stars of SEMA Show 2010 in the section TT Off Road, Rally Fighter Here is the impressive development and developed by Local Motors. A car that we had found the prototype last year at the SEMA Show and arriving here at SEMA 2010 in its final form and delivered in 5 different finishes.

This special self Runs Out, Off Road, Baja Rally Raid is built around a tubular frame built with the technology space frame covered with a carbon fiber body according to the technique of thermoforming. This is a car from a very fine gauge since its imposing dimensions:

Length: 4.80 m
Width: 2.57 m
Height: 1.76 m
Wheelbase: 2.92 m

A look of Mad Max car and features that should enable the Rally Fighter devour everything off the roads. 4-wheel independent suspension deflections impressive:

Front: 46 cm

Ar: 51 cm

Large ventilated disc brakes with dual piston calipers with ABS, an assisted rack and pinion steering, a rear wheel drive and above all a GM 6.2 L V8 engine of 430 hp and 575 Nm of torque in the base model because the motor can be offered to customers in several versions that can go up to 520 horses. In all cases, the V8 LS3 is attached to a BVA also from GM. Depending on the configuration of the tracks or the race, the car is registered for wheels from 17 to 20 inches. The advertised weight is about 1425 -1450 kg depending on the equipment. And for those who are interested, know that the car is available with two rear seats

London introduces its new double-decker bus 2011

It is a symbol of London and Great Britain. Saturday, the mayor of the British capital, Boris Johnson, presented at the London Transport Museum's new model red double-decker bus, the famous 'double-decker'. More rounded shapes, return to an open platform on the floor, this model is clearly inspired by the classic Routemaster. Manufactured by Wrightbus, the new 'double decker' will begin in early next year on a test size in the streets of London. Top five models entering them into service in 2012 when the British capital hosts the Olympics.
